2026년 상식닷컴 선정 식당 & 카페 리스트
최근에 오픈한 호텔을 찾는다면 살펴보세요

서클CI의 빌드 인프라 사용량 모니터링 방법은?

_____
Q: 서클CI 빌드 인프라 사용량을 어떻게 모니터링할 수 있나요?
A: 서클CI 대시보드 내 'Insights' 탭을 통해 프로젝트별 빌드 실행 현황, 실행 시간, 성공률 등을 실시간으로 확인할 수 있습니다.

Q: AWS 리소스나 자체 호스팅 환경에서 빌드 인프라 사용량은 어떻게 확인하나요?
A: 자체 호스팅 또는 클라우드 환경에 따라 인스턴스 모니터링 도구(AWS CloudWatch, Prometheus 등)를 연동하여 빌드 컨테이너 CPU, 메모리, 네트워크 사용량을 추적할 수 있습니다.

Q: 서클CI 요금 청구서에서 인프라 사용량을 알 수 있나요?
A: 네, 청구서 내 ‘사용량’ 항목에 실행된 워크플로우 수, 사용된 분 단위 컴퓨팅 시간이 명확히 표기됩니다. 이를 통해 월별 인프라 사용량을 간접적으로 파악할 수 있습니다.

Q: 빌드 사용량 알림을 설정할 수 있나요?
A: 서클CI 플랜에서는 Usage Notification 및 API를 통해 사용량 임계치 도달 시 이메일 알림 혹은 웹훅 알림 설정이 가능합니다.

Q: 빌드 시간과 리소스 사용량을 더 자세히 분석할 수 있는 방법은?
A: 서클CI API를 활용해 빌드 및 워크플로우의 실행 통계 데이터를 추출 후, 자체 대시보드나 외부 시각화 도구(예: Grafana, Data Studio)에 연동하여 심층 분석할 수 있습니다.

Q: 빌드 인프라 사용량 최적화를 위한 팁이 있나요?
A: 캐싱 활용, 병렬 실행 제한, 불필요한 잡 최소화, 적절한 리소스 클래스 선택 등을 통해 인프라 비용과 사용량을 효율적으로 관리하는 것이 좋습니다.

Q: 무료 플랜 사용자의 인프라 사용량 제한은 어떻게 확인하나요?
A: 무료 플랜은 월별 빌드 분수 제한이 있으며 대시보드에서 현재 사용량과 잔여 분수를 실시간 조회할 수 있습니다.

Q: 서클CI에서 제공하는 인프라 사용량 관련 리포트를 받을 수 있나요?
A: 서클CI에서는 주기적인 사용량 리포트 이메일을 제공하며, 필요 시 API를 통해 맞춤형 데이터도 요청할 수 있습니다.
서클CI(CircleCI)의 빌드 인프라 사용량을 모니터링하는 방법에는 여러 가지가 있습니다.

아래에 몇 가지 주요 방법과 도구를 소개합니다.

1. CircleCI 대시보드 사용 CircleCI의 웹 대시보드를 통해 프로젝트와 관련된 빌드의 상태와 사용량을 쉽게 모니터링할 수 있습니다.

대시보드는 각 빌드의 시간, 성공률, 실패 이유 등을 시각적으로 보여줍니다.



2. API 활용 CircleCI는 REST API를 제공하여 프로그램matically하게 빌드 인프라와 관련된 데이터를 조회할 수 있습니다.

이를 통해 CI/CD 파이프라인의 성능 및 사용량을 분석할 수 있는 맞춤형 대시보드를 구축할 수 있습니다.

- API Endpoint 예시 : - `/project/:vcs-type/:username/:project/builds`: 특정 프로젝트의 빌드 목록을 가져옵니다.

- `/project/:vcs-type/:username/:project/stats`: 통계 정보를 제공합니다.



3. 통계 및 보고 기능 CircleCI는 빌드와 관련된 다양한 통계 기능을 제공합니다.

빌드 성능, 사용 시간 및 비용을 분석하기 위한 다양한 메트릭을 제공합니다.

이 정보를 활용하여 언제 어떻게 인프라를 사용하는지 파악할 수 있습니다.



4. 리소스 사용 모니터링 CircleCI의 Enterprise 버전에서는 빌드 실행에 사용되는 리소스(가상 머신, Docker 이미지를 포함한 컨테이너 등)의 사용량을 더 세부적으로 모니터링할 수 있는 기능이 제공됩니다.



5. 서드파티 도구 통합 CircleCI와 연동할 수 있는 여러 서드파티 도구(예: Datadog, Prometheus 등)를 통해 빌드 성능 및 리소스 사용률을 실시간으로 모니터링하고 알림을 설정할 수 있습니다.

이러한 도구들은 대시보드, 경고 시스템을 통해 보다 복잡한 모니터링을 가능합니다.



6. 커스텀 알림 및 대시보드 구축 Slack, 이메일 등과 같은 통신 도구와 통합하여 빌드 성공 및 실패, 리소스 사용량에 대한 알림을 설정할 수 있습니다.

이러한 방식은 팀의 협업을 돕고 실시간으로 인프라 사용량을 모니터링하는 데 유용합니다.

이러한 방법들을 통해 서클CI의 빌드 인프라 사용량을 효과적으로 모니터링할 수 있습니다.

이를 통해 팀은 빌드 성능을 최적화하고, 비용을 관리하며, 추적 가능한 CI/CD 파이프라인을 유지할 수 있습니다.

작성자: 최윤재 [비회원] | 작성일자: 1년 전 2025-03-22 03:01:45
조회수: 166 | 댓글: 0 | 좋아요: 0 | 싫어요: 0
내용이 부정확하다면 싫어요를 클릭해주세요.